Tag Emulation enables a device to act as an NFC card, allowing other NFC readers to detect and communicate with it. This is commonly used in applications that need to emulate various NFC card types (such as MIFARE Ultralight, NTAG, etc.).
Main steps for tag emulation:

Please remove the PICC from the reader This example demonstrates how to use StackChan to implement e-wallet functionality, supporting two modes:
Non-rechargeable E-Wallet (Click): Supports only deduction operations, preventing illegal recharging, suitable for one-time consumption scenarios. This mode disables recharging through specific permission settings, ensuring that consumption amounts can only decrease and never increase.
Rechargeable E-Wallet (Hold): Supports both deduction and recharge operations, suitable for scenarios requiring repeated recharging. Through reasonable permission configuration, both operations are allowed, providing a more flexible user experience.
The core principle of NFC e-wallet is to use MIFARE Classic card's Value Block to store and manage amount information. Value Blocks use a special internal format including data backup and anti-tampering mechanisms. Each value block occupies one block space on the card (16 bytes), containing: amount value (4 bytes), amount complement backup (4 bytes), amount backup (4 bytes), complement backup (4 bytes). This redundant design prevents data from being maliciously tampered with.

Core Difference: The key difference between the two modes is the permission bit setting. Non-rechargeable mode disables the Increment command through permission bit configuration, while rechargeable mode allows both operations.
